Output 12db782c7298a8740ab03cc9dc6d58f2ba430ad7bbba15460d88f672504a59f9:16

value
10181614
script pubkey
OP_0 OP_PUSHBYTES_20 27964ed94098663dc5f1857bc31788c83c550c6a
address
bc1qy7tyak2qnpnrm303s4aux9ugeq792rr20leel6
transaction
12db782c7298a8740ab03cc9dc6d58f2ba430ad7bbba15460d88f672504a59f9
confirmations
150258
spent
true